Hey every one, as I think I have mentioned before, I bought 2 heritage grandes and they wouldn't flow after the second or third run. I contacted Lava Lite, and they sent two more lamps (very nice of them), but these also had flow issues.  Anyway, I am almost 100% sure adding a second coil would get these going. Anybody know of a good source of coils, I know there have been discussions about replacement coils before, but I though maybe there is a better source available now. I tried the plated steel springs from Lowes, and they began rusting in my aristocrat.  I was thinking maybe 5 below lamps? What do you guys think?

Rick it does sound like an overheating issue...I would definitely try a dimmer before you turn to goo kitting.  Not that I wouldn't mind kitting a grande but it does take a whole entire quart of goo and quite a bit of distilled water.  Still you would get awesome flow from a kitted grande.  I usually don't like to give up on my LL's until there's just nothing more that I can improve upon.

I'm happy to report I figured mine out. You were right Carol, totally an overheating problem. I took both my Starships apart and found that the socket was about a quarter of an inch higher (closer to the globe) and it had a high intensity S11N bulb instead of a regular S11N. I adjusted the height of the socket to the same as the other one and straightened it so it's centered, put them back together and it ran great for over 3 hours after warming up. So after I get a regular intensity bulb it should be good.
